Camel Roll
Camel Rolls are made from the all natural, tough, durable 100% skin of camels with nothing artificial. These long-lasting treats satisfy the natural chewing instinct, and provide a safe, hypoallergenic treat for dogs of all breeds and ages.
approx 12cm
£9.00Price
No Reviews YetShare your thoughts.
Be the first to leave a review.

